Transaction dd3eca2cce69180d179e7d65d5d1256478782f4bceccbe17507aa49497a63834
1 Input
1 Output
-
dd3eca2cce69180d179e7d65d5d1256478782f4bceccbe17507aa49497a63834:0
- value
- 4790677
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3adc4aae489bf8b9f79ba5700a692a6f272855a7 OP_EQUAL
- address
- 374F1omJ6LnbFEkwv1MstTBkRbbck5BMYt